A RHODIAN POTTERY FIGURAL ARYBALLOS
CIRCA 600-580 B.C.
In the form of a recumbent ram, its head turned to its right, with large underslung horns, the vessel mouth at the crown of the head, details in black including for the horns, hooves, and eyes, hatching on the fleece, dots above the brow and along the vessel rim, traces of red pigment preserved in the ears
4¾ in. (12.1 cm.) long
Provenance
Leo Mildenberg, Zurich, prior to 1981.
The Leo Mildenberg Collection; Christie's, London, 26-27 October 2004, lot 17.
Literature
A.P. Kozloff, ed., Animals in Ancient Art from the Leo Mildenberg Collection, Part I, Cleveland, 1981, p. 115, no. 96.
